More than 200 exhibits occupied 49,400 sq ft--the largest exhibit space in the show's history. Among the prominently displayed equipment were casting machines, instrumentation, automation and robotic equipment, and software for streamlining metalcasting. In addition to the exhibits, more than 60 technical presentations detailed research and development from 11 nations. Bus tours also gave attendees the opportunity to see diecasting in operation at 14 different plants. |
